PIC16C55-XTI/SS Microchip Technology, PIC16C55-XTI/SS Datasheet - Page 33

IC MCU OTP 512X12 28SSOP

PIC16C55-XTI/SS

Manufacturer Part Number
PIC16C55-XTI/SS
Description
IC MCU OTP 512X12 28SSOP
Manufacturer
Microchip Technology
Series
PIC® 16Cr
Datasheet

Specifications of PIC16C55-XTI/SS

Core Processor
PIC
Core Size
8-Bit
Speed
4MHz
Peripherals
POR, WDT
Number Of I /o
20
Program Memory Size
768B (512 x 12)
Program Memory Type
OTP
Ram Size
24 x 8
Voltage - Supply (vcc/vdd)
3 V ~ 6.25 V
Oscillator Type
External
Operating Temperature
-40°C ~ 85°C
Package / Case
28-SSOP
For Use With
309-1026 - ADAPTER 28-SSOP TO 28-DIP
Lead Free Status / RoHS Status
Lead free / RoHS Compliant
Eeprom Size
-
Data Converters
-
Connectivity
-
6.5
As a program instruction is executed, the Program
Counter (PC) will contain the address of the next pro-
gram instruction to be executed. The PC value is
increased by one, every instruction cycle, unless an
instruction changes the PC.
For a GOTO instruction, bits 8:0 of the PC are provided
by the GOTO instruction word. The PC Latch (PCL) is
mapped to PC<7:0> (Figure 6-7, Figure 6-8 and
Figure 6-9).
For
PIC16CR57, PIC16C58 and PIC16CR58, a page num-
ber must be supplied as well. Bit5 and bit6 of the STA-
TUS Register provide page information to bit9 and
bit10 of the PC (Figure 6-8 and Figure 6-9).
For a CALL instruction, or any instruction where the
PCL is the destination, bits 7:0 of the PC again are pro-
vided by the instruction word. However, PC<8> does
not come from the instruction word, but is always
cleared (Figure 6-7 and Figure 6-8).
Instructions where the PCL is the destination, or modify
PCL instructions, include MOVWF PCL, ADDWF PCL,
and BSF PCL,5.
For
PIC16CR57, PIC16C58 and PIC16CR58, a page num-
ber again must be supplied. Bit5 and bit6 of the STA-
TUS Register provide page information to bit9 and
bit10 of the PC (Figure 6-8 and Figure 6-9).
FIGURE 6-7:
GOTO Instruction
CALL or Modify PCL Instruction
Note:
2002 Microchip Technology Inc.
the
the
Reset to ’0’
Program Counter
PC
PC
Because PC<8> is cleared in the CALL
instruction, or any modify PCL instruction,
all subroutine calls or computed jumps are
limited to the first 256 locations of any pro-
gram memory page (512 words long).
PIC16C56,
PIC16C56,
8
8
7
7
Instruction Word
Instruction Word
LOADING OF PC
BRANCH INSTRUCTIONS
- PIC16C54, PIC16CR54,
PIC16C55
PCL
PCL
PIC16CR56,
PIC16CR56,
0
0
PIC16C57,
PIC16C57,
Preliminary
FIGURE 6-8:
FIGURE 6-9:
CALL or Modify PCL Instruction
CALL or Modify PCL Instruction
GOTO Instruction
GOTO Instruction
PC
PC
PC
PC
7
7
7
7
10
10
2
10
2
10
2
2
0
0
0
0
9
9
STATUS
9
STATUS
9
PA<1:0>
STATUS
PA<1:0>
STATUS
PA<1:0>
PA<1:0>
Reset to ‘0’
Reset to ‘0’
8 7
8 7
8 7
8 7
LOADING OF PC
BRANCH INSTRUCTIONS
- PIC16C56/PIC16CR56
LOADING OF PC
BRANCH INSTRUCTIONS
- PIC16C57/PIC16CR57,
AND PIC16C58/
PIC16CR58
Instruction Word
Instruction Word
Instruction Word
Instruction Word
PIC16C5X
PCL
0
PCL
PCL
0
PCL
0
0
DS30453D-page 31
0
0
0
0

Related parts for PIC16C55-XTI/SS